Tina Fey and Steve Carell are set to reunite for Netflix's eight-episode comedy series The Four Seasons, in which they'll play a married couple for the second time.
The 53-year-old Mean Girls producer and the 61-year-old Office alum will begin production later this year on the remake of Alan Alda's critically-acclaimed 1981 feature directorial debut co-starring Carol Burnett, whose famous catchphrase was 'Are we having fun yet?'
The Four Seasons - featuring composer Antonio Vivaldi's four concerti - centers on three middle-class married couples taking seasonal vacations together (New York, Virgin Islands, Connecticut, and Vermont) and how their friendships and relationships change and evolve.
The $6.5M-budget film amassed $50.4M at the box office, received four Golden Globe Award nominations, and spawned a 13-episode CBS spin-off in 1984.

Tina is co-creating The Four Seasons with fellow 30 Rock alums Lang Fisher and Tracey Wigfield, and she enlisted her husband of 22 years - Jeff Richmond - to be one of the producers.
Fey and Carell previously played bored married couple Phil and Claire Foster in Shawn Levy's 2010 rom-com about mistaken identity titled Date Night, which amassed $152.3M from a $55M budget at the global box office despite bad reviews.
Steve will make his big Broadway debut as Ivan Petrovich Voinitsky in The Lincoln Center's revival of Uncle Vanya, which opens Wednesday night and runs through June 16 at the Vivian Beaumont Theater in Manhattan.
Lila Neugebauer directs Heidi Schreck's new version of the 1897 Anton Chekhov play also starring Tony Award nominees Alfred Molina and Alison Pill.
The Asteroid City actor will also voice purple furry creature Blue in John Krasinski's live-action comedy - hitting US/UK theaters May 17 - alongside Ryan Reynolds, Phoebe Waller-Bridge, and Louis Gossett Jr.
Carell is also set to reprise his voiceover role as Anti-Villain League agent Gru in Chris Renaud's animated comedy Despicable Me 4, which hits US theaters July 3 and UK theaters July 5.
The Illumination family flick also features Kristen Wiig, Will Ferrell, Sofía Vergara, Chloe Fineman, Stephen Colbert, and Steve Coogan.
